Creating Meaningful Vows and Heartfelt Declarations
Writing your own vows and declarations is a beautiful way to personalize your wedding ceremony and express your love and commitment to your partner in a unique and heartfelt manner. Here are some tips to help you craft meaningful vows and declarations that will touch the hearts of your loved ones:
Tips for Writing Vows:
- Reflect on your relationship and what your partner means to you.
- Write from the heart and be sincere in your words.
- Include specific promises and commitments that are meaningful to you both.
- Consider incorporating your shared values, beliefs, and aspirations into your vows.
- Keep it concise and focused on the essence of your love and partnership.
Sample Vows:
Here are some examples of vows to inspire you:
- "I promise to support you in all your dreams and goals, to cherish and respect you, and to be your partner in all things."
- "I vow to laugh with you in times of joy, and comfort you in times of sorrow, to be your confidant and your best friend."
Heartfelt Declarations:
In addition to vows, consider making heartfelt declarations of love during your ceremony. These can be spoken by you, your partner, or even a close friend or family member.
Sample Declarations:
- "I declare my unwavering love for you, my commitment to stand by your side through all of life's challenges, and my gratitude for the joy you bring to my days."
- "I declare that you are my rock, my safe haven, and my greatest love. I am honored to walk this journey of life with you, hand in hand."
Remember, the most important thing is to speak from the heart and let your genuine emotions shine through in your vows and declarations. Your words will create a lasting memory of your special day and the love you share with your partner.
